I ran into the same problem. We're running fw 4.0, and some research showed that it would be a trick under 4.1 to talk to cisco IOS, and would not work at all with 4.0. We bought a Cisco router and stuck it in a separate DMZ. We still can log who goes where, and can limit access. Not perfect but we're not ready to go to 4.1 one yet.
